About Memfault
Memfault is the first IoT reliability platform that empowers teams to build more robust devices at scale. Today hardware teams have little insight into how their products are performing, and what issues are driving the majority of field failures, with Memfault they can operate with the same speed and agility as software organizations. Companies such as Logitech, Bose, Whoop, and Verkada use Memfault’s performance monitoring, device debugging, and OTA update capabilities to ship fast and build high quality products. Memfault was founded by veterans of Pebble, Fitbit, and Oculus, and is backed by fantastic investors such as YCombinator and Uncork Capital.
